Leopold "Butters" Stotch is a fictional character in the adult animated television series South Park. He is loosely based on co-producer Eric Stough and his voice is provided by co-creator Matt Stone. He is a student at South Park Elementary School.

Butters is depicted as more naïve, optimistic, and gullible than the show's other child characters and can become increasingly anxious, especially when faced with the threat of being grounded, which terrifies him. As a result, he is often sheltered and unknowledgeable of some of the suggestive content his peers understand, and is also frequently bullied by Eric Cartman.
